Description
M/A-COM’s MA4ST1200 series is a highly repeat- able, UHCVD/ion-implanted, hyperabrupt silicon tun- ing varactor in a cost e ffective surface mount pack- age. This series of varactors is designed for high capacitance ratio, and high Q for low battery voltage operation. It is efficient for wide band tuning and low phase noise application where the supply voltage is limited to 5 volts or less. The Varactors are offered as Singles in SC-79, and SOD-323 along with a Common Cathode version offered in the SC-70, 3 Lead. These diodes are offered with standard Sn/Pb plating , as well as with 100% matte Sn plating on our RohS compliant equivalent devices. Mounting Information The illustration indicates the recommended mounting pad configuration for the SC-79, SOT-323 and SOD-323 packages. Solder paste containing flux should be screened onto the pads to a thickness of 0.005- 0.007 inches. The plastic package is placed in position, firmly adhering to the solder paste. Permanent attachment is performed by a reflow soldering procedure during which the tab temperature does not exceed +275 °C and the body temperature does not exceed +250 °C, for standard models and +260 °C for the RoHS compliant devices. Please refer to Application Note M538 for surface mounting instructions.
